Bhanwari case: Raj HC not happy with the probe

Jodhpur: The Rajasthan High Court on Thursday expressed displeasure over the pace of probe in the case of missing nurse, Bhanwari Devi.

A division bench of justices Govind Mathur and NK Jain expressed displeasure over the investigation into the case and directed the government counsel to produce the status report on October 17, the next date of hearing.

The bench said the investigation has just changed hands but the responsibility of the state government is still there to search and produce before the court the nurse missing since September one.

The CBI had taken charge of the investigations into the case yesterday.

Counsel of petitioner Amarchand, husband of Devi, said despite the lower court's direction to include state minister Mahipal Maderna's name in the FIR, no action has been taken against him.

The Court had earlier raised questions on the state government's intention of solving the case.
